Release checklist — Murkwell gateway. Confirm log sampling is enabled before cutover. The chatty-path handlers in routefan emit per-request debug lines; at peak this floods Lanternsink and blows the ingest quota. Set sample rate to 1:50 on INFO, keep ERROR unsampled. Verify the override flag is absent in prod config, since last sprint it silently forced full logging. Dashboards should show volume dropping within five minutes. Sign off in the sync notes once the sampled build is live, referencing the token below.

session token of bawep-yadup = htk21_528abd376e3c5a4ec24a1

During the arrival of the Ashden intern cohort, all new starters must sign in at the main desk and wear visitor lanyards until permanent passes are issued. Interns may not escort guests or hold doors for unbadged persons. Movement beyond the second floor requires an escort. Until your badge is ready, use the temporary entry code below.

door code, bagef-yafop: bdg-ZFZML-07646

New folks: ownership of Murmur, the audio-guide app for the Hollowgate Museum, has moved. Scope includes tour playback, offline packs, beacon triggers, and the content sync pipeline. Old escalation doc is obsolete; ignore it. Bugs go to the Murmur board, not general support. Release sign-off, store submissions, and content-update approvals all route through one person now. No exceptions, no side channels. Read the handover notes on the wiki before your first ticket. Effective immediately, the responsible owner is:

signatory, kafop-bahaf: Lamion Queniel Jorir Olidor